My brother’s ‘18, however, did. Same deal as you, he had to steer with one hand and hold the door closed with the other. I suspect right turns were a *****.![]()
He did get it fixed. In fact, he made the dealer fix all four doors even though only one door was problematic. Apparently they attach some kind of a water shield over the latch mechanism on the door. Keeps water from getting in there and then freezing up.Damn I feel bad for your bro. This door thing is such nightmare especially since you don’t know when it will happen.

So last night I went to move my shifter and it broke. As in physically broke in half, only thing holding it together was a small ribbon cable. I tried to shut it off and hoped it would shift it into Park. No such luck. Yes it is “supposed” to shift into park when you do this but all that happened was it stayed in Drive and flashed on/off. It’s all plastic and I’m hoping this isn’t a design flaw that shows up in colder weather. I’m in WI and it gets a lot colder than this.
Called Ford Roadside Assistance and they got a flatbed dispatched in less than a half hour which was amazing BUT I went to the dealer this morning only to find a technician crawling on the ground scratching his head why it won’t come out of drive…
I don’t have any other info as of right now but talked to the service manager 2 hours after I was there and they said they still haven’t gotten it out of drive!
